Global Cannabis Use Up 40% Over Last Decade as Reform Spreads, but Overlap With Illicit Market Growing
Use of cannabis across the globe has grown by 40% over the last decade, with 256m people now reported to have used cannabis over the past year in 2024. That growth, according to the United Nations Office on Drugs and Crime‘s World Drug Report 2026 (WDR26), follows a ‘continuum of gradual normalisation’ towards cannabis use, which in turn has helped drive a fragmented, but expanding wave of policy liberalisation.
